INPUT.Radio {
	border : none;
	width : 20;
}
BODY,HR  {
	color : Black;
	font : 10pt Arial;
	padding : 0;
	background-color : #99CCFF;
	margin : 0;
}

H2  {
	font : 18pt Arial;
}

.maptitle {
	font : 16pt Arial;
	font-weight : bold;
}

INPUT, SELECT  {
	margin : 0;
	width : 13em;
	border-style : outset;
	padding : 0;
	font : 9pt Arial;
	color : navy;
}

INPUT.small  {
	margin : 0px;
	width : 50px;
}

INPUT.Xlarge  {
	margin : 0px;
	width : 240px;
	border-style : inset;
}

INPUT.over  {
	background-color : Blue;
	color : white;
}

INPUT.out  {
	background-color : Silver;
}

INPUT.oversmall  {
	color : white;
	background-color : #3366FF;
	margin : 0;
	width : 50px;
}

INPUT.textbox  {
	border-style : inset;
	width : 150px;
}

INPUT.smalltextbox  {
	margin : 0;
	width : 55px;
	border-style : inset;
}

A:hover  {
	color : white;
	background-color : #008080;
	
}

A.Image:hover  {
	background-color : #C0C0C0;
}

A.nohover:hover  {
	background-color : #99CCFF;

}


font.head3  {
	font : 14pt Arial;
}

font.head2  {
	font : 18pt Arial;
}

TABLE  {
	padding : 0;
	margin : 1;
	color : #0000FF;
	font : 9pt Arial;
}

